Ed-Fi Alliance Interoperability Framework centers on an explicit data model that maps education domains to versioned schemas, which helps keep integrations consistent across systems. Integration depth comes from a standardized API surface that supports CRUD workflows for operational entities like students, staff, schools, courses, and assessments. Extensibility is handled through governed mechanisms so district-specific fields can be added without breaking base contracts. Automation relies on connector logic that translates SIS, LMS, SIS-adjacent exports, and assessment systems into schema-compliant API calls.

A tradeoff appears in the up-front schema and mapping work required before high-throughput sync can run reliably. The framework fits best when multiple upstream systems must publish the same education entities to downstream consumers under controlled governance and audit expectations. One common usage situation is a district building an interchange layer that keeps enrollment and grading updates flowing across data warehouses and reporting tools on a predictable cadence.

Microsoft Power Platform combines Power Apps, Power Automate, and Dataverse under a unified governance and extensibility model for school workflows. Dataverse provides a structured data model with tables, relationships, and environment-scoped solutions that support consistent schema management.

Power Automate runs workflow logic with connectors and an automation surface that maps to Microsoft 365, Teams, and Azure services. Admin controls, RBAC, and audit logging help enforce access boundaries across makers, admins, and deployed app components.

Salesforce Education Cloud extends Salesforce’s CRM data model with education-specific entities like programs, classrooms, and learning activities. Integration depth is driven by Salesforce APIs, including REST and SOAP endpoints plus eventing for connected systems.

Automation and administration rely on declarative tools plus a managed extensibility layer for custom objects, fields, and workflows. Governance is handled through RBAC, sandboxed development, and audit logging for traceability across org changes.
